Our verdict is Uncertain significance. Variant got 0 ACMG points: 2P and 2B. PM1BP4_Moderate
The NM_000551.4(VHL):c.585G>C(p.Gln195His)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000041 in 1,461,874 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★★).

Von Hippel-Lindau syndrome;C1837915:Chuvash polycythemia Uncertain:1
This sequence change replaces glutamine, which is neutral and polar, with histidine, which is basic and polar, at codon 195 of the VHL protein (p.Gln195His). This variant is present in population databases (no rsID available, gnomAD 0.0009%). This variant has not been reported in the literature in individuals affected with VHL-related conditions. 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 238112). Algorithms developed to predict the effect of missense changes on protein structure and function output the following: SIFT: "Not Available"; PolyPhen-2: "Benign"; Align-GVGD: "Not Available". The histidine amino acid residue is found in multiple mammalian species, which suggests that this missense change does not adversely affect protein function. In summary, the available evidence is currently insufficient to determine the role of this variant in disease. Therefore, it has been classified as a Variant of Uncertain Significance. -

Hereditary cancer-predisposing syndrome Uncertain:1
The p.Q195H variant (also known as c.585G>C), located in coding exon 3 of the VHL gene, results from a G to C substitution at nucleotide position 585. The glutamine at codon 195 is replaced by histidine, an amino acid with highly similar properties. This amino acid position is poorly conserved in available vertebrate species. In addition, the in silico prediction for this alteration is inconclusive. Since supporting evidence is limited at this time, the clinical significance of this alteration remains unclear. -
